Frequently Asked Questions

Get answers to common questions about Nose - Exterior Waxing.

Most clients report only mild discomfort during Nose - Exterior Waxing; the procedure is quick. Any redness subsides within hours, and our gentle technique plus aftercare minimizes irritation. Numbing products available on request.

We recommend Nose - Exterior Waxing every three to six weeks, depending on your hair growth rate. Regular appointments keep the area tidy and hair finer over time; our therapist advises a personalized schedule during consultation.

Nose - Exterior Waxing is generally safe for sensitive skin when performed by professionals. We conduct a brief skin check and can use hypoallergenic wax and soothing post-care. Inform us about sensitivities or medications beforehand.

Avoid touching or picking the area, and skip heavy products for 24 hours. Gently cleanse and apply a calming gel if needed. Avoid hot baths, saunas, and intense exercise for 24 hours to minimize irritation.

Exterior waxing reduces ingrown hairs compared with shaving because hair is removed from the root. Some rare bumps may occur; exfoliate gently after 48 hours and use soothing products to prevent irritation and promote smooth regrowth.

Please postpone Nose - Exterior Waxing if you have active cold sores, open wounds, recent sinus surgery, or are using acne medications like isotretinoin. Inform our team about medical conditions or blood-thinning medications before treatment.
